Abstract

β-Cyclodextrin can act as an efficient inhibitor of the photosensitized dimerization of thymine by para-aminobenzoic acid (PABA) in aqueous solution. This can be explained by considering the formation of an inclusion complex between PABA and β-cyclodextrin.
